What on Earth is Concrete-Effect Quartz Anyway?

Before we go any further, let’s clear something up. When we talk about concrete-effect quartz, we’re not talking about a slab of actual concrete. Real concrete is porous, stains easily (imagine spilling a bit of red wine or curry on it!), and can crack. It’s a brilliant material for building bridges, not so much for a busy family kitchen.

Instead, this is an engineered stone. Think of it as a clever mix of natural materials and modern technology, designed to give you the best of both worlds.

A Simple Breakdown: Nature Meets Nurture

At its heart, a quartz worktop is made of about 90-95% natural quartz crystals. Quartz is one of the hardest minerals on Earth, which is why these worktops are so tough. The crystals are ground down into a fine powder or small aggregates.

This natural quartz is then mixed with a small amount of polymer resins—a type of plastic that acts like a super-strong glue, binding everything together. Finally, pigments are added to create the desired colour and pattern. To get that cool, industrial concrete look, manufacturers use a blend of grey, white, and black pigments, often adding subtle textures and variations to mimic the raw, unfinished feel of real concrete.

The whole mixture is then poured into a mould, compressed under immense pressure (we’re talking tonnes of it), and baked in a kiln to cure it. This process, known as the Bretonstone process, creates a solid, non-porous slab that’s incredibly dense and durable.

Detailed Explanation: The Technical Bit

The magic of concrete-effect quartz lies in its engineered composition. The use of polymer resins is key. Unlike natural stones like marble or granite, which have tiny pores and fissures, the resin fills every single gap between the quartz particles. This makes the final slab non-porous.

This is a huge deal for a kitchen worktop. A non-porous surface means that liquids can’t seep in and cause stains. It also means bacteria, mould, and mildew have nowhere to hide, making it a far more hygienic choice. The compression and curing process also ensures the slab has a consistent structure and strength throughout, without the weak spots that can sometimes be found in natural stone.

So, when you choose concrete-effect quartz, you’re getting the raw, edgy aesthetic of concrete without any of the practical headaches. It’s tough, it’s clean, and it looks fantastic.

The Story of the Industrial Look: From Factory Floors to Fitted Kitchens

The industrial aesthetic didn’t just appear out of nowhere. Its roots go back to a time when cities like Manchester, Sheffield, and Glasgow were the workshops of the world. The look is all about celebrating the raw, functional beauty of the materials that built our modern world: brick, metal, wood, and, of course, concrete.

A Bit of History: The Rise of Loft Living

The trend really took off in the 1960s and 70s in cities like New York and London. Artists and creatives, looking for large, affordable spaces, began moving into abandoned warehouses and factories in areas like SoHo in New York and Shoreditch in London.

Instead of covering up the building’s history, they embraced it. They left brick walls exposed, kept the original steel beams, and polished up the old concrete floors. It was a look born out of necessity, but it quickly became a style statement. It was honest, unpretentious, and effortlessly cool.

This “loft living” aesthetic slowly trickled into mainstream interior design. People started to appreciate the beauty in imperfection—the rough texture of a brick wall, the patina on a copper pipe, the subtle variations in a concrete surface.

How It’s Made: The Journey from Crystal to Countertop

We’ve touched on how concrete-effect quartz is made, but it’s worth taking a closer look at the process. Understanding the technology and craftsmanship involved helps you appreciate why it’s such a premium and reliable material.

The vast majority of engineered quartz worldwide is made using the patented Bretonstone system, invented in Italy in the 1960s. It’s a highly controlled process that guarantees quality and consistency.

Step 1: Sourcing the Raw Materials

It all starts with the quartz. High-quality quartz crystals are sourced from around the world. These are inspected for purity before being crushed and ground into different sizes, from coarse grains to a super-fine powder. The size of these aggregates plays a big part in the final look of the slab. For a convincing concrete effect, manufacturers often use a mix of very fine powders to create a smooth, dense base, with slightly larger grains added to create subtle texture and movement.

Step 2: Mixing and Blending

The quartz aggregates are then moved to computer-controlled mixing machines. This is where the magic happens. The quartz is blended with the polymer resins and the carefully selected pigments. For a concrete look, this isn’t just a case of chucking in some grey colouring. Master technicians create complex recipes, using multiple shades of grey, black, and sometimes even hints of beige or brown, to replicate the natural, mottled appearance of poured concrete.

Step 3: Moulding and Pressing (Vibrocompression)

The mixture, which now has the consistency of damp sand, is poured into a large mould, usually measuring around 3 metres by 1.4 metres. The mould is then subjected to a process called vibrocompression under vacuum.

  • Vacuum: First, the air is sucked out of the mixture. This is a crucial step that removes any tiny air pockets, which could create weak spots in the final slab.
  • Vibration and Compression: The mould is then vibrated intensely while being compressed with around 100 tonnes of pressure. This forces the quartz particles incredibly close together, creating a super-dense and compact slab.

Step 4: Curing (Heating)

The compressed slab is moved from the mould to a huge curing kiln or oven. It’s heated to a temperature of around 90-100°C for a set period. This process triggers a chemical reaction in the resin, causing it to harden and permanently bond the quartz particles together. This is what gives the slab its final strength and stability.

Step 5: Finishing and Polishing

Once cured and cooled, the slab is perfectly solid but has a rough surface. The final stage is to calibrate it to the exact required thickness (usually 20mm or 30mm for worktops) and then polish it.

The slab passes through a series of polishing heads fitted with diamond abrasive pads. It starts with coarse pads to grind the surface flat and moves to progressively finer pads to create the desired finish. For concrete-effect quartz, the most popular finish is often matte or honed. Unlike a high-gloss polished finish, a matte surface has a soft, low-sheen look that feels much more like real concrete. Some premium finishes might even have a slightly textured or “brushed” feel to enhance the industrial vibe.

Step 6: Quality Control

Before it leaves the factory, every single slab undergoes rigorous quality control checks. It’s inspected for any surface imperfections, colour inconsistencies, and structural defects. Only slabs that meet the highest standards are approved for sale.

This meticulous, technology-driven process is why engineered quartz is so consistent in quality. Unlike natural stone, where every slab is different and can have hidden flaws, you know exactly what you’re getting with a reputable brand of quartz.

The Unbeatable Practicality

Let’s be honest, our kitchens work hard. They have to cope with spills, hot pans, sharp knives, and general family chaos. Concrete-effect quartz is more than up to the challenge.

  • Stain Resistant: Because it’s non-porous, things like coffee, wine, lemon juice, and olive oil can’t penetrate the surface. Just wipe them away with a cloth and some mild detergent. This is a huge advantage over real concrete or marble, which can stain permanently.
  • Scratch Resistant: Being made of 90%+ natural quartz, it’s incredibly hard and resistant to scratches. You should still always use a chopping board, but you don’t have to panic if a knife slips.
  • Low Maintenance: Unlike granite or marble, which need to be sealed regularly to protect them, quartz never needs sealing. It’s a fit-and-forget solution. Cleaning is a breeze—just soap and water will do the trick.
  • Hygienic: The non-porous surface means there’s nowhere for germs to linger, making it an excellent choice for food preparation areas.

The Chameleon of Kitchen Design

One of the biggest appeals of concrete-effect quartz is its incredible versatility. It can look right at home in a huge range of different kitchen styles.

  • The Pure Industrial Look: For the full warehouse vibe, pair a dark grey concrete-effect worktop with a handleless matt black or dark blue kitchen. Add in some exposed brick, metal pendant lights, and open shelving for a look that’s straight out of a Shoreditch loft.
  • The “Industrial-Luxe” Style: This is a very popular look in the UK right now. It softens the hard edges of industrial design with a touch of glamour. Think a light grey concrete-effect worktop paired with deep green or navy shaker-style cabinets. Then add in warm metallic accents like brass or bronze taps and handles. It’s a sophisticated and grown-up take on the trend.
  • The Scandi Vibe: The minimalist, natural feel of Scandinavian design works beautifully with concrete-effect quartz. Combine a pale grey worktop with simple, flat-panelled cabinets in light oak or white. Keep the rest of the space clean and uncluttered for a calm and airy feel.
  • The Modern Farmhouse: Even in a more traditional setting, concrete-effect quartz can work. In a modern farmhouse kitchen, it can provide a contemporary contrast to classic elements like a Belfast sink and shaker cabinetry. It stops the whole look from feeling too twee or old-fashioned.

Choosing the Right Shade and Finish

Don’t assume all concrete-effect quartz looks the same. There’s a huge range of options out there, from pale, almost white-greys to deep, dramatic charcoals.

  • Get Samples: This is the most important tip. Never, ever choose a worktop from a picture online or a tiny sample in a showroom. You need to get a decent-sized sample (at least 10cm x 10cm) and look at it in your own kitchen. See how it looks in the morning light, under your artificial lights in the evening, and next to your chosen cabinet colour.
  • Consider the Finish: Most concrete effects come in a matte or honed finish. A matte surface is great at hiding fingerprints and has a lovely, soft feel. However, some people find that very dark matte surfaces can show up grease marks more easily (though they are simple to clean). A polished finish will reflect more light, which can be good for a smaller, darker kitchen, but it doesn’t look as authentically “concrete.”
  • Look at the Details: Pay attention to the patterning. Some designs have very subtle, uniform textures, while others have more dramatic veining or mottling to mimic the look of hand-poured concrete. Think about what will work best with the other elements in your kitchen.

Finding a Good Fabricator

Buying a quartz worktop isn’t like buying a fridge. You don’t just order it and have it delivered. The slab needs to be professionally cut and installed by a specialist stone fabricator.

The fabricator is the company that will come to your home to create a precise template of your kitchen units. They then use that template to cut the slabs to size using specialist saws and CNC machinery, creating cut-outs for your sink and hob. They’ll finish the edges and then come back to install it.

Common Pitfalls to Avoid

Quartz is incredibly tough, but it’s not indestructible. Here are a few things to keep in mind:

  • Heat: While quartz is heat-resistant, it’s not heat-proof. A sudden change in temperature (thermal shock) can potentially crack it. Always use a trivet or heat pad for hot pans straight from the hob or oven. Don’t just put them directly on the surface.
  • Harsh Chemicals: Stick to gentle, pH-neutral cleaners. Avoid harsh chemicals like bleach, oven cleaner, or nail polish remover. If you do spill something nasty, clean it up immediately with water.
  • The “Chippendale” Effect: The edges and corners are the most vulnerable part of any worktop. A heavy blow from a cast iron pan could cause a chip. Be mindful when handling heavy cookware around the sink and edge areas. If a chip does happen, it can often be repaired by a specialist.

Cleaning and Care: Keeping It Simple

This is the easy part. For daily cleaning, a soft cloth and a bit of soapy, warm water is all you need. Wipe it down, rinse off with clean water, and then dry it with a clean microfibre cloth to avoid water spots and streaks. For a more stubborn mark, a non-abrasive cream cleaner (like Barkeeper’s Friend or Cif Cream) on a soft sponge will usually do the trick. That’s it. No sealing, no waxing, no special treatments required.

The Future of the Industrial Look: What’s Next?

The industrial trend shows no signs of slowing down, but it is evolving. We’re moving towards a more refined and comfortable version of the look, sometimes called “soft industrial” or “industrial-luxe.”

We’ll likely see more concrete-effect quartz designs that incorporate warmer tones, such as greige (a mix of grey and beige) or subtle brown undertones. Textures will become even more sophisticated, with finishes that look and feel like real, tactile materials.

The focus will continue to be on mixing materials. Think concrete-effect quartz paired with fluted wood panelling, reeded glass, and rich, warm metals. It’s about creating a space that feels layered, interesting, and deeply personal—a home that is both stylish and liveable.
